Benefits may include:

Army Reserve (Part-Time)

  • Health professions special pay for physicians in eligible specialties
  • A monthly stipend through the Specialized Training Assistance Program (STRAP) for physicians currently enrolled in an accredited residency program up to $2,540 per month
  • Health Professions Loan Repayment Program (HPLRP) which repays qualifying education loans to lending institutions up to $250,000
  • Travel opportunities
  • Enrollment in the Uniformed Services Blended Retirements System
  • Low-cost medical and dental care for you and your family
  • Commissary and post exchange shopping privileges
  • Specialized training to become a leader in General Surgery

Requirements:

  • Doctor of medicine or doctor of osteopathy degree from an accredited U.S. school of medicine or osteopathy; foreign graduates may apply with permanent certificate from the Educational Council of Foreign Medical Graduates
  • Current license to practice medicine in the United States, District of Columbia or Puerto Rico
  • Eligibility for board certification in General Surgery
  • Completion of at least one year of an approved graduate medical education internship
  • Between 21 and 58 years of age
  • U.S. citizenship- Full & Part-Time*
  • Permanent U.S. residency- Part-Time Only*
